Address 0 DCR

Dsct95ar9PtPjvgh4zeudekFXCdkdkEgDfT

Confirmed

Total Received20.11766212 DCR
Total Sent20.11766212 DCR
Final Balance0 DCR
No. Transactions2

Transactions

Fee: 0.000747 DCR
651058 Confirmations20.11766212 DCR